AutoHub 3.67

No 8/26, Ground floor, Nageswara Road, Nungambakkam,
Chennai, 600003
India

Contact Details & Working Hours

Map of AutoHub

Updates from AutoHub

Reviews of AutoHub

   Loading comments-box...